During Baasha's reign, there was continuous warfare between Israel and Judah (the two kingdoms of the Jews after Israel split into two about 2900 years ago). Baasha worshiped idols. He was told, by the Lord, through a prophet, that because of his sins, he and his family would be destroyed. When Baasha died, his son Elah became king. The story of Baasha is found in 1 Kings, chapters 15 and 16."@en . . . "This fulfilled a prophecy of Ahijah.
